みんなの「教えて(疑問・質問)」にみんなで「答える」Q&Aコミュニティ

こんにちはゲストさん。会員登録(無料)して質問・回答してみよう!

解決済みの質問

パーミッションについて

フリースペースを使ってHPを作り始めました。
そこで、パーミッションの設定の部分で疑問が生じたので質問させてください。

パーミッションの2桁目はグループに対しての設定のようですが、
この「グループ」とは一体何を表しているのでしょうか?
同一フリースペースを利用した他のHPの製作者を指しているのでしょうか?
もし、パーミッションの二桁目を許可した場合、
他のHPのCGIやらの影響を受けることもあるんでしょうか?

投稿日時 - 2005-03-10 09:55:31

QNo.1260861

困ってます

質問者が選んだベストアンサー

グループとは、同一サーバを利用している他のユーザーです。
同一フリースペースを利用した他のHPの製作者を指しているのでしょうか?・・・そうなります。

二桁目を許可した場合、telnet経由でCGIのソース(本体)を見ることができてしまいます。(telnetが使えなくてもその他(nobody)権限においてhttp経由で見ることはできますが、それを考えるとキリがありません。suExecを採用しているサーバーであればユーザー権限(700)で動きます。

できるだけ数字は小さくして余計な権限を与えないことが基本です。

投稿日時 - 2005-03-10 10:39:04

お礼

回答ありがとうございます。

HPの閲覧者だけでなく、同一フリースペースの他の利用者の
影響も考えなきゃですね。

悪意を持った人が同じフリースペースを借りて、
グループ権限でイタズラすることもありうるんですね。
気をつけます。

投稿日時 - 2005-03-10 13:49:42

このQ&Aは役に立ちましたか?

2人が「このQ&Aが役に立った」と投票しています

回答(2)

ANo.1

サーバー上でのグループのことなので
そのサーバーを利用するユーザーのうち
どのユーザーがどの(どういう)グループに属しているのかは
サーバー管理者でないとわかりません。

投稿日時 - 2005-03-10 10:26:59

お礼

回答ありがとうございます。

投稿日時 - 2005-03-10 13:27:42

あなたにオススメの質問